Webpowerlifting 1.4K views, 36 likes, 20 loves, 68 comments, 15 shares, Facebook Watch Videos from ROCKsteady ENT.: OCEANIA POWERLIFTING & BENCH PRESS CHAMPIONSHIPS 2024 - DAY 2 WebMar 22, 2024 · One of these studies gave 37 older men with an average age of 71 years either 0 grams, 10 grams, 20 grams, or 40 grams of whey protein after a leg workout using only one leg. Twenty grams were enough to increase muscle protein synthesis in the exercised leg, but 40 grams were more effective.
